Abstract

The invention relates to a metering reporting method for round trip time (RTT) of radio links, which has a step A that a wireless network controller sends RTT measurement information to a base station, a step B that the base station searches the current multi-path information to find out the minimum phase multi-path with the energy exceeding the set threshold value and then to calculate RTT value, a step C that the base station determines whether the RTT measurement period is completed or not, if not, the procedure transfers to the steps B, otherwise, a steps D is implemented. The step D is to calculate the average value of all calculated RTT values and the average value is used as the RTT measurement value of the RTT measurement period and reported to the report them to the wireless network controller. RTT measurement value obtained by the present invention is more close to actual wireless application environment, so that the positioning accuracy of the system is further raised.

Background technology
3GPP has mainly defined the location technology of three kinds of wireless terminals in network, wherein a kind of localization method that is based on CellId (cell ID), in order to improve locating accuracy, for FDD (FrequencyDivision Duplex, frequency division multiplexing) pattern also can be measured to the RTT that NodeB (base station) initiates Radio Link by radio network controller (RNC).
As shown in Figure 1, for adopting UE (User Equipment, subscriber equipment) location schematic diagram based on CellId+RTT.Wherein, elliptic region is the coverage of sub-district, and the black blockage is the position of NodeB, the UE position ring that dotted line is determined for RTT information.If only know CellId information, positioning UE is the coverage of sub-district, i.e. elliptic region so; If known RTT information, can positioning UE be that dotted line and elliptic region intersect a belt strip, i.e. arc between intersection point A and the B among Fig. 1 then.This shows, adopt RTT to measure, can orient the current location of UE more accurately, improve the positional accuracy of system.
3GPP is defined as RTT:
RTT=T RX-T TX
Wherein, T TXFinger sends to the beginning delivery time of descending DPCH (Dedicated Physical Channel, the DPCH) frame of UE, and reference point is the transmitting antenna mouth, T RXRefer to corresponding up DPCCH/DPDCH (Dedicated Physical Control Channel from UE, Dedicated Physical Control Channel/Dedicated Physical Data Channel, Dedicated Physical Data Channel) frame the beginning time of reception, reference point is the reception antenna mouth.
In the actual environment, because the existence of factors such as reflection, diffraction, produced the communication effect of multipath, in the WCDMA system, adopt code word to carry out user's differentiation, so these multipath information can be used, with decline to antinoise signal, in actual process, effective multipath information of obtaining is many more, then can improve the anti fading ability.Therefore, when uplink demodulation was handled, the base station need be searched for, and obtained multipath information, in order to instruct demodulation.In search multipath method, a kind of method of guiding and supporting is arranged, its basic principle is exactly that when antenna diversity received, if on an antenna multipath information is arranged, thinking so also should have multipath information on the identical position of another antenna; The multipath that is each antenna can be guided and supported mutually, and like this, non-guide and support footpath of multipath information except receiving also comprises the footpath of guiding and supporting of guiding and supporting out mutually, might be empty footpath and guide and support the footpath, therefore, might comprise empty footpath information in the multipath information that the base station obtains.
According to the definition of agreement, what adopted when calculating RTT in the existing technology is the multipath of phase place minimum in the multipath information, and concrete computational methods comprise the steps: as shown in Figure 2
Step S11, RNC issue RTT to the base station and measure message;
Step S12, base station obtain the multipath information of a frame signal correspondence;
Step S13, calculate the RTT value of the minimum multipath of phase place;
Step S14, if RTT does not arrive the finish time measuring period, then go to step S12, continue the measurement of next frame signal; If arrive in measuring period, execution in step S15;
Step S15, ask for the mean value of a plurality of RTT values that calculate in this measuring period;
Step S16, the mean value of trying to achieve is reported RNC, be used for assist location;
Step S17, finish this RTT and measure flow process.
In above-mentioned RTT method of measurement, in the multipath information of a possible frame signal correspondence, the multipath of phase place minimum is empty footpath, and adopts the empty RTT that directly calculates inaccurate, when being used for assist location, can make the result of location bigger deviation occur.

Embodiment
When the minimum multipath of the present invention's phase place in available technology adopting multipath information carries out RTT calculating, might adopt empty footpath to calculate, thereby cause the inaccurate problem of result of calculation, in the multipath information that search is come out, only select for use energy to carry out RTT and calculate greater than the minimum multipath of the phase place of setting the energy threshold value.Concrete grammar is: calculate the energy of every the multipath that searches, and respectively with the energy threshold value of a setting relatively, filter out energy greater than the multipath of setting thresholding; The phase place of the whole multipaths that relatively filter out again, the multipath of choosing the phase place minimum carries out RTT and calculates.In order further to guarantee the validity of RTT measured value, can set the signal frame threshold value that comprises described multipath in the measuring period, will not adopt less than the RTT measured value that reports the measuring period of threshold value for frame number, have only frame number just to be used for the location greater than the RTT measured value that reports the measuring period of threshold value.
As shown in Figure 3, be the flow chart of the specific embodiment of the invention, in this embodiment, adopt a counter that is arranged on the base station to come the signal frame number that comprises described multipath is added up, concrete steps are as follows:
Step S21, RNC issue RTT to the base station and measure message;
Step S22, make the counter reset;
Step S23, base station obtain the multipath information of a frame signal correspondence;
Step S24, base station judge whether energy greater than the multipath of setting the energy threshold value, if, execution in step S25; Otherwise, go to step S27;
Step S25, calculate the RTT value of the minimum multipath of phase place, continuation the following step;
Step S26, make counter add " 1 ", continue the following step;
Step S27, base station judge whether RTT arrives the finish time measuring period, if not, then goes to step S23, continue the measurement of next frame signal; If arrive in measuring period, continue step S28;
Step S28, judge counter value whether greater than the signal frame threshold value of setting, if not, execution in step S29; If, execution in step S30;
Step S29, abandon all RTT values that calculate in this measuring period, reporting to radio network controller temporarily to provide effective measured value information; Execution in step S31;
Step S30, ask for the mean value of the whole RTT values that calculate, report radio network controller as the RTT measured value of this measuring period; Execution in step S31;
Step S31, finish this RTT and measure flow process.
